They happened behind closed doors and beyond parents\u2019 eyes. For 142 years over 15,000 children attended the Mohawk Institute Indian Residential School on Six Nations lands adjacent to Brantford. Within its walls generations of children would suffer physical or sexual abuse and be subjected to back breaking labour all while never knowing if they would ever leave . The school closed in 1970, becoming a place where some survivors and their families would not even set foot. Until the Woodland Cultural Centre (WCC) began their \u2018Save the Evidence campaign\u2019 to turn it into a safe space to spread awareness about what really went on at Canada\u2019s longest-running residential school.
